Cheeseburger with Bacon, Lettuce, Tomato, and Onion
Ingredients:
For the Burger Patties:
1 lb ground beef
1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
Salt and pepper, to taste
1 tsp garlic powder
1 tsp onion powder
For the Burger Toppings:
4 slices cheddar cheese
4 slices bacon
1 tomato, sliced
1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
1/2 cup lettuce, shredded
4 burger buns
Ketchup and mustard (optional)
Instructions:
Prepare the Burger Patties:
Preheat a grill or skillet over medium-high heat.
In a bowl, mix ground beef,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.
Shape the beef mixture into 4 equal patties.
Cook the patties on the grill or skillet for 4-5 minutes per side, or until they reach your desired doneness. During the last minute of cooking, place a slice of cheddar cheese on each patty to melt.
Cook the Bacon:
While the patties cook, heat a pan over medium heat and cook the bacon until crispy.
Remove from the pan and set aside on paper towels to drain.
Assemble the Burger:
Toast the burger buns in the pan or on the grill until lightly golden.
Spread ketchup and mustard on the bottom half of the buns (optional).
Layer the lettuce, tomato slices, red onion, and the cheese-covered burger patty on the bottom bun.
Top with crispy bacon and place the top bun on top.
Serve this loaded, juicy cheeseburger with your favorite sides like fries or a salad for a satisfying meal!
